Immerse yourself in the abstract expressionist vision of Edward Corbett with this museum-quality reproduction of his 1950 work, Untitled. This piece captures the raw, emotive energy of post-war American art, where Corbett masterfully blends gestural brushwork with a subdued palette to evoke introspection and atmospheric depth. As a leading figure in the San Francisco art scene, Corbett’s work from this era reflects a profound exploration of form and feeling, making it a timeless addition to any discerning collection.
